Product features
"ALL SYSTEMS" CALIBRATION PACKAGE
Go beyond LDW with calibration hardware for camera, radar, lidar, night vision, around-view monitoring, blind spot detection, and rear collision warning systems on equipped vehicles.
OPTICAL POSITIONING TECHNOLOGY
Six integrated high-definition cameras automatically position calibration targets, reducing setup time by up to 6X compared to traditional mechanical measurements.
BUILT-IN ALIGNMENT PRE-CHECK
Verify vehicle alignment conditions before calibration to help ensure calibration requirements are met before the process begins.
UNLEVEL FLOOR COMPENSATION
Intelligent compensation technology helps maintain calibration accuracy while reducing failed calibrations caused by uneven shop floors.
ROBOTIC CROSSBAR POSITIONING
Automated crossbar movement improves target placement consistency while reducing technician setup time and increasing productivity.
MODULAR & MOBILE DESIGN
Quickly disassembles for easy transport, storage, and mobile calibration services while moving efficiently between service bays.

What is the difference between the IA700AST and IA700AS?
The IA700AST includes the MaxiSYS MS909S2 tablet, wireless VCI, J2534 pass-thru programming device, and ADAS calibration software upgrade card. The IA700AS does not include the tablet or ADAS software upgrade.
Which ADAS systems can the IA700AST support?
Depending on the vehicle and OE-required procedure, the package supports Lane Departure Warning, Adaptive Cruise Control, Front Collision Warning, Rear Collision Warning, Blind Spot Detection, Around View Monitoring, lidar, and night vision calibration.
Does the IA700AST include the diagnostic tablet?
The package includes the MaxiSYS MS909S2 diagnostic tablet.
Is the ADAS software included?
An Autel® ADAS Calibration Software Upgrade Card is included in the package.
Does the IA700AST perform wheel alignments?
No. It performs an optical wheel alignment pre-check to compare vehicle alignment conditions against manufacturer tolerances before ADAS calibration.
Can I use existing Autel ADAS targets with this system?
Yes. The IA700 platform is compatible with Autel® MA600 and IA900 targets, patterns, and calibration components.
* Perform calibrations only in a controlled indoor environment. The i700 is designed to help technicians reach a suitable controlled environment; calibration should not be performed outdoors, in parking lots, or in uncontrolled areas.
* Control the surrounding environment carefully. Maintain appropriate lighting, use neutral-colored surroundings, and avoid walls or objects with patterns that could be mistaken for calibration targets.
* Keep the calibration area free from outside interference such as wind that could move targets during the procedure.
* Make sure the vehicle is positioned on a suitable level surface when performing alignment checks or rolling compensation. Avoid slopes where the vehicle cannot be safely controlled during the rolling procedure.
* Always follow the vehicle-specific and OEM instructions provided by the system. Required target dimensions, distances, and positioning must not be changed from the specified requirements.
* Ensure tire clamps remain securely positioned and do not move during the rolling compensation process, as movement can affect alignment readings.
* Ensure sufficient space is available around the vehicle and calibration frame before starting. The required distance varies according to the vehicle and calibration procedure.
* For radar calibration, do not leave the metal calibration frame in front of the vehicle when the procedure requires it to be removed. Follow the specified reflector and laser positioning procedure.
* Always verify the completed calibration and retain the generated report as documentation that the procedure was performed correctly.
